Job description

Washington College is seeking a Junior Geospatial Developer to support ongoing GIS initiatives and contribute to the development of geospatial tools, applications, and data solutions.

The Junior Geospatial Developer supports the design and implementation of scalable GIS system architectures in support of GIP’s sponsor-funded and partner-supported initiatives. The position contributes to application development, automation workflows, and integration of data and analytical outputs into web-based and enterprise geospatial systems.

The role participates in the software development lifecycle (SDLC), assisting with development, testing, deployment, and maintenance of geospatial applications. The Junior Geospatial Developer works under the guidance of senior engineering staff to ensure code quality, documentation consistency, and reliable system performance.

Essential Functions:

  • Assist in developing web-based and enterprise GIS applications across cloud and hosted environments.
  • Contribute to application architecture design and system integration under senior guidance.
  • Participate in the software development lifecycle, including requirements review, development, testing, and deployment support.
  • Integrate datasets and analytical outputs into dashboards, web applications, and geospatial services.
  • Develop and maintain APIs and automated geoprocessing workflows as assigned.
  • Follow established coding standards, documentation practices, and version control procedures.
  • Conduct testing and troubleshooting to improve system reliability and performance.
  • Collaborate with data specialist and analytics teams to support integrated solution delivery.
  • Maintain technical documentation for application features and workflows.
  • Support experiential learning activities by collaborating with student teams and interns on development tasks.

Requirements

  • Experience integrating spatial data into web applications.
  • Coursework or experience in API development, automation scripting, or related technical workflows.
  • Experience with or familiarity using JavaScript and Python in applied development environments.
  • Familiarity with cloud-based databases and backend platforms, such as Firebase.
  • Ability to create automated scripts, data workflows, or AI-assisted tools and agents to support project delivery.
  • Interest in creative problem-solving and system architecture, including practical, scalable solutions for geospatial and data-driven projects.
  • Familiarity with or willingness to learn server setup, maintenance, or deployment workflows.
  • Willingness to mentor interns; prior mentoring experience is a plus.
